Beautiful view from the Uellenbecke of the church, village and bridge on the Schemm. Legend has it that the road was to be built further down, directly behind the houses. Because a resident was concerned about her children near the road, she asked the workers to build the road further up. The planner is said to have been horrified later. Pragmatic and flexible 50s!

The monastery was founded by the Knights of the Cross in the 13th century; the current monastery church dates from 1497, although the portal probably comes from the previous building. After the abolition during secularization, Cardinal Frings sent crusaders to Beyenburg again. Today it is the last monastery in Wuppertal that is still occupied by a monk.

If you really like "Bergisch", you should take a look at Beyenburg. Slate and green shutters are part of the cityscape here.
